Russians attack 40 settlements in Kherson region over past day, leaving nine injured

In the Kherson region over the past day, the city of Kherson and about 40 other settlements in the region were under drone and artillery fire, with casualties and significant damage.

The Kherson Regional Military Administration stated this on Telegram, Ukrinform reports.

"Over the past day, under enemy drone terror and artillery shelling were Zymivnyk, Bilozerka, Tarasa Shevchenka, Urozhayne, Petrivka, Beryslav, Rakivka, Darivka, Novoraisk, Kyselivka, Charivne, Poniativka, Sadove, Antonivka, Tomyna Balka, Komyshany, Sofiivka, Pravdyne, Mykilske, Dniprovske, Molodizhne, Osokorivka, Stanislav, Oleksandrivka, Shyroka Balka, Burhunka, Zelenivka, Zolota Balka, Ivanivka, Kizomys, Lvove, Mylove, Naddniprianske, Novodmytrivka, Prydniprovske, Tokarivka, Tomaryne, Tyahynka, and the city of Kherson," the statement said.

Russian troops struck critical, transport, and social infrastructure, residential neighborhoods, damaging five apartment buildings and 11 private houses. The occupiers also damaged a gas pipeline, farm buildings, a cultural center, and private cars.

As a result of Russian aggression, 8 people were wounded, and one more person later sought medical help.

As reported, during the morning of Saturday, June 27, five people were injured in Kherson and the suburbs as a result of Russian attacks.
